The resource is typically organized into sections covering fundamental algebraic topics. These may include simplifying expressions, solving linear equations, working with inequalities, and understanding systems of equations. Questions often range from basic computational exercises to more complex word problems that require the application of algebraic concepts to practical scenarios. Visual aids, such as graphs and diagrams, may also be incorporated to enhance understanding and provide alternative representations of algebraic relationships.

To maximize the benefits, begin by reviewing the relevant algebraic concepts before tackling the exercises. Work through each problem carefully, showing all steps in the solution process to facilitate understanding and error identification. If encountering difficulties, revisit the concept explanations or seek assistance from teachers or peers. Regularly review completed work to reinforce learning and identify areas for further practice. Consistency and a deliberate approach are key to effectively mastering the material.
